“多边之友小组”(FMG)和世界经济论坛(WEF) 联合举办“中国在WTO改革上的立场”高级别晚餐会

2019-06-01

 

2019年5月29日,日内瓦“多边主义小组”(Friends of Multilateralism Group, FMG)和世界经济论坛(WEF)联合在日内瓦举办了“中国在WTO改革上的立场”高级别晚餐会。会议由FMG联合召集人卢先堃教授和WEF国际贸易与投资总监Sean Doherty主持。

晚餐会上,对外经贸大学WTO研究院屠新泉教授做了主旨发言,围绕中国于5月13日向WTO提交的《中国关于世贸组织改革的建议文件》,从学术视角介绍了中国在WTO改革上的立场。欧盟、瑞士、印度、墨西哥、新西兰、澳大利亚、新加坡、挪威等10个WTO成员的大使和副代表、FMG多位成员以及“FMG之友”(FFMG)参加,就WTO改革、中国立场和作用以及中美贸易冲突的影响等展开了热烈讨论。

The Friends of Multilateralism Group

(FMG简介)

The Friends of Multilateralism Group (FMG), established in 2016 in Geneva, is agroup of independent experts firmly committed to promoting multilateralism andshared growth within the multilateral trading system (MTS). They mainly includeformer senior trade diplomats, former senior staff of internationalorganizations and renowned scholars. FMG endeavors to buttress efforts byMembers, both delegations and capital officials, on WTO reform and other issuesof importance to the MTS and help them restore the centrality of the WTO forthe governance of trade and investment. FMG will strive to providehigh-quality, independent and expert advice through a series of activities andproducts, including researches, debates, consultations and policy advice, tohelp build a positive eco-system to inform and support potential compromisesand landing zones for the sustainability of the multilateral trading system.

FMG is co-organized by Alejandro JARA and Xiankun LU. Itsmembers include Richard BALDWIN, Daniel CROSBY, Simon EVENETT, StuartHARBINSON, Bernard HOEKMAN, Anabel GONZALEZ, Alejandro JARA, Patrick LOW,Xiankun LU, Hamid MAMDOUH, Hector TORRES, Guillermo VALLES. FMG engagesextensively external independent experts, as need be.

Some representatives of relatedinternational organizations are also invited in theirpersonal capacity, as“Friends of FMG” (FFMG), to enrich the discussions and bridge effectivemessage-passing with such organizations. FFMG members areVictor DO PRADO (WTO),  Sean DOHERTY(WEF), Pamela Rosemarie Coke Hamilton (UNCTAD), Jos VERBEEK (WB), and AnthonyWilson (ITC).
